1.前言社会上对保护环境和空气质量越来越重视。因此,许多国家规定了公路车辆汽油机废气中允许有害物质的极限值,对一氧化碳、氧化氮和碳氢化合物的含量实行了限制。因为柴油机废气中所含有害物质的浓度要比汽油机的低(图1),所以至今只有美国的加利福尼亚,根据13级试验规定了极限值。目前,在欧洲共同体范围内,对公路车辆有害物质的排放作出了法律上的规定。
1. Introduction There is a growing emphasis in the community on the protection of the environment and air quality. As a result, many countries have set limits on the amount of harmful substances that may be allowed in the exhaust of gasoline engines for road vehicles, limiting the levels of carbon monoxide, nitrogen oxides and hydrocarbons. Because diesel engine exhaust contains less harmful substances than gasoline engines (Figure 1), so far only California in the United States has set limits based on a Class 13 test. At present, within the European Community, the law sets out the emission of harmful substances on road vehicles.
